The Slovakia Fusion Biopsy market is witnessing steady growth driven by the rising incidence of prostate cancer and the increasing adoption of advanced diagnostic techniques. Fusion biopsy combines mag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) with ultrasound to provide more accurate and targeted biopsies, leading to improved detection rates and reduced unnecessary procedures. The market is characterized by the presence of key players offering innovative fusion biopsy systems and software solutions. Healthcare facilities in Slovakia are increasingly investing in advanced medical technology, supporting the growth of the fusion biopsy market. Furthermore, collaborations between healthcare providers and technology companies for research and development activities are expected to drive market expansion. Overall, the Slovakia Fusion Biopsy market is poised for continuous growth with a focus on improving diagnostic outcomes for prostate cancer patients.
